THE iDOLM@STER SideM (anime)

From The iDOLM@STER: SideM Unofficial English Wiki

The Animation Project is an adaptation of the series. Like the 2011 adaptation of the original The iDOLM@STER series, the Animation Project is by A-1 Pictures, a studio subsidiary of Sony Music Entertainment's anime production firm Aniplex.

Development[edit | edit source | hide | hide all]

The adaptation was first announced on the second day of THE IDOLM@STER SideM 2nd STAGE ~ORIGIN@L STARS~ concerts at the Makuhari Messe on February 12, 2017 . A promotional video announcing the adaptation was uploaded to YouTube on the same day.

A livestream on Nico Nico Douga took place on March 15, 2017, otherwise known as "Saikou Day." The event took place at the Ani ON AKIHABARA Bookstore in front of a live audience and was hosted by Shuugo Nakamura and Yuuma Uchida, with special guests Yuichiro Umehara, Shun Horie, and Tomohito Takatsuka.[1] A second PV was released and a second key visual was revealed, both featuring the members of Beit. The staff members were also announced and posted on the Official Anime site. [2]

A second Nico livestream was held on Thursday, April 13, entitled "If There's a Reason, NicoStream! ~Side Animation~". It was hosted by Umehara, Horie, and Takatsuka, with special guests soon to be announced. [3]

Episode List[edit | edit source | hide]

Official episode titles by Crunchyroll are displayed below, with a more direct translation in marked in tooltip text if applicable.
No. Title Director Writer Original air date
0 THE IDOLM@STER Prologue SideM -Episode of Jupiter- Yukie Sugawara September 30, 2017
A special prologue episode for the series. It focuses on Jupiter's idol activities and their transition to 315 Productions after the events of THE IDOLM@STER anime.
1

"An Idol With a Past!"
"Wake atte, aidoru!" (理由あって、アイドル!)

Takahiro Harada October 7, 2017
Teru Tendo has been recruited to the fledgling talent agency 315 Production. Despite being wary of the circumstances surrounding the decision, he joins and forms a group with Tsubasa and Kaoru. They may be bad now, but can they muster up the drive and passion to become a successful idol group?
2

"Where Each Star Shines"
"Sorezore no Kagayaki" (それぞれの輝き)

Yukie Sugawara October 14, 2017
Now that 315 Productions has recruited enough people, it's been decided they get promotional photos. They want to stand out and show themselves to the public, but their methods end up making the photos look ridiculous. Meanwhile, Jupiter is about to stage its first concert under 315 - but thanks to a typhoon, their usual crew can't make it in on time. Not only do the boys of 315 have to think of a new theme, but they have to find a way to help Jupiter's first concert be a success...
3

"Courage to Fly"
"Tobitatsu Yuuki" (飛び立つ勇気)

Yukie Sugawara, Yuniko Ayana October 21, 2017
DRAMATIC STARS is about to stage its own first concert. Tsubasa is happy to be able to participate, but he soon has a nasty case of stage fright -- the light of the stage reminds him of his first outing as a pilot, where he froze up during turbulence and was too scared to do anything lest he accidentally crash the plane. The emotions start flooding back, and he soon feels like he wants to quit DRAMATIC STARS -- if he could fail then, why not now and ruin his teammates' dreams? Teru and Kaoru need to find a way to reassure him and keep the trio together.
4

"Happy Smile"
"HAPPII SUMAIRU" (ハッピースマイル)

Akiko Waba October 28, 2017
While filming for a community video about the strip mall Beit used to work for, they learn of a festival being used to promote it that might give the mall the edge over the planned new indoor mall by the Takajo Corporation. The group decides to preform there with High×Joker providing backup, and they take in the sights of the festival as it's being set up. Pierre accidentally wanders into a truck and gets taken with it; with only a few hours away before the mini concert, it's up to Beit and Pierre's bodyguards to find him before it's too late.
5

"Teachers, Be Ambitious!"
"Sensei yo, Taishi o Idake!" (先生よ、大志を抱け!)

Yuniko Ayana November 4, 2017
S.E.M is going to be holding their debut concert at a private school, so they need to get themselves in shape for the event. The rest of 315 is put on an early morning training regimen with them, but Jiro's struggling to keep up with their energy. The teachers do their best to stay on track for the school concert, but they're going to need a lot more than drive to fulfill their dream...
6

"Victory Chosen by Both"
"Futari ga Erabu Victory" (二人が選ぶVictory)

Akiko Waba November 11, 2017
Producer is rushed to the hospital where he meets a soccer player, Yusuke who stays at a neighbor room and his twin brother, Kyosuke, who plays soccer with him. Yusuke has an injury from recklessly playing soccer. The doctor reports that Yusuke's injury is severe, so he can't play soccer like he used to anymore. Kyosuke feels guilty and blames Yusuke's injury on himself. Between their promise and hard times, they make a decision to move on from soccer stars to idols.
7

"Limit of Youth"
"Seishun no RIMITTO" (青春のリミット)

Yuniko Ayana November 18, 2017
High×Joker's Shiki has an idea to make a documentary video to promote their band. Shiki starts filming the other members's activity and their daily life, which make Jun feel annoyed to Shiki's hype. Shiki also visits Haruna's construction site and breaks into Jun's house. Finally, everyone reveals what they think High×Joker has brought them.
8

"Beach, Training Camp, 315 Summer!"
"Umi, Gasshuku, 315 no Natsu!" (海・合宿・315の夏!)

Yukie Sugawara November 25, 2017
315 Production will make their biggest concert where every unit will go on stage. Producer decides to hold a training camp at the beach with everyone.
9 "Over AGAIN..." Yasuhiro Nakanishi December 1, 2017
Jupiter members are working as solo with another unit. Touma and Teru visit the concert hall where their concert is held. Shouta goes filming a TV show with W and Hokuto, along with Rui from S.E.M for a radio program. After they're back from work the situation after Jupiter's concert in Episode 0 is finally revealed.
10 "Sunset of Youth" Akiko Waba December 8, 2017
High×Joker plans to hold a live concert at their school. Hayato has a plan to show the new song in the concert. The news is spread by Shiki but Jun isn't happy about it, since it puts pressure on Hayato. Jun blames Shiki for announcing this too early, being scared of what would happen if the song isn't finished by the live concert. However, Shiki keeps trying to promote the concert because he wants everyone to come and watch their concert. Finally, the song is finished with help from everyone.
11

"Resolution on a Breezy Day"
"Kazekaorubi no Ketsui" (風薫る日の決意)

Yasuhiro Nakanishi December 15, 2017
Kaoru starts a solo job along side his idol job which makes everyone worry about him. Teru has a plan to make him go on vacation at a hot spring so he may relax. However, after the hot spring trip everything geso worse when Producer rejects his TV series offer and Kaoru then desires to work without Producer's permission.
12

"No Matter the Reason, No Matter the Dream..."
"Donna Wake mo, Donna Yume mo,,," (どんな理由(ワケ)も、どんな夢も、、、)

Yuniko Ayana December 22, 2017
Continuing from the last episode, Kaoru keeps on working solo which make everyone worry that he can perform a live concert. Unfortunately, Kaoru falls sick from working hard. The drama between the DRAMATIC STARS members starts again with Kaoru's background story.
13

"Move Forward Forever and Ever"
"Zutto, Zutto, Sono Saki e" (ずっと、ずっと、その先へ)

Yukie Sugawara December 29, 2017
This episode is a live concert starting from High×Joker, S.E.M, W, Beit, Jupiter, and DRAMATIC STARS. At the end of concert they all perform the anime's signature song, Reason!!. After the concert they celebrate the Christmas at the office. Producer keeps on scouting new idols and everyone keeps on working.
SP

"315 Variety Pack! Made In Passion!"
"315 BARAETI PAKKU! Made In Passion!" (315バラエティパック! Made In Passion!)

Akiko Waba
This episode is a special episode, available in the limited-edition CD. This episode contains an unseen story which was cut from the original story and the "Passion of the Passion" story.

Staff[edit | edit source | hide]

  • Original Work: Bandai Namco Entertainment
  • Director: Takahiro Harada (原田孝宏) and Miyuki Kuroki (黒木美幸)
  • Series Structure: Yuniko Ayana (綾奈ゆにこ) and Yukie Sugawara (菅原雪絵)
  • Character Design: Yuusuke Tanaka (田中裕介) and Haruko Iizuka (飯塚晴子)
  • Chief Animation Director: Yuusuke Tanaka (田中裕介) and Maho Yoshikawa (吉川真帆)
  • Color Design: Asuka Yokota (横田明日香)
  • Art Design: Kazushi Fujii (藤井一志)
  • Art Director: Hisayo Usui (薄井久代)
  • 3D Director: Akira Fukuda (福田 陽)
  • Cinematographer: Yukiko Nagase (長瀬由起子)
  • Editing: Akinori Mishima (三嶋章紀)
  • Music: EFFY
  • Sound Director: Takatoshi Hamano (濱野髙年)
  • Animation Studio: A-1 Pictures
